Men dominate history because they write it. This book offers a reappraisal which aims to re-establish women's importance at the centre of the worldwide history of revolution, empire, war and peace. As well as looking at the influence of ordinary women, it looks at those who have shaped history.

The author explores where nationalism comes from and where it is taking us. He explains how nationalism was distorted into Nazism and Communism - and how a resurgence of nationalism defeated both.
